Serving the SO21 area of Winchester, Colden Chemist is a community pharmacy registered with the General Pharmaceutical Council under number 1102126. It is owned by GAD Healthcare Ltd and passed its most recent GPhC inspection. Community pharmacies of this kind handle NHS and private prescriptions, stock a range of over-the-counter medicines and can offer guidance on everyday health concerns. The specific services available at any given branch can vary, so it is sensible to contact the pharmacy directly before making a trip. It is worth knowing that, since 2018, doctors in the UK have been able to legally prescribe cannabis-based medicines for certain conditions. This happens through specialist clinics, not through ordinary community pharmacies.
